Wirral Vets is an IVC Evidensia practice in Wirral, Cheshire. It offers routine consultations, preventative care and discussion of treatment options, with recent feedback often praising clear explanations, friendly staff and calm handling of nervous pets. Most recent comments are positive, though there is also an isolated complaint about booking, communication and medication advice.
